Coming to Google Street View the Rhätische Bahn

Google Street View has photographed the route of the Glacier Express and the Bernina Express over the mountain lines of the Rhätische Bahn in the Swiss Canton of Graubünden. The line is photographed from Thusis, where the line leaves the Rhine River, over the Alps to Tirano in Italy.

FTL (provided/translated):In Part: “…Used was a trike, tricycle with a specially built camera that was placed on a flat rail wagons. The recordings are now being tested qualitatively and assembled afterwards. This process takes several months, such as Google and the Rhaetian Railway (RhB) announced on Tuesday. Probably early next year could be taken the virtual train ride from Thusis to Tirano RhB spokesman said Peider Härtli…”
